Parks & Blacktop Options & Info

Carnival: $1,460/day
South of South Expo: $330/day
North of North Expo: $730/day
North of Drivers Training: $930/day
North of Premium Building: $535/day
South of Premium Building: $200/day
Rose Garden: $1,100/day
West of Eureka Lane: $1,100/day
West of Food Row: $1,100/day
Fountain Restroom: $1,100/day
Gazebo: $930/day

Scam Alert

We are aware of scammers commenting on our Expo Idaho event posts and directly contacting vendors claiming that vendor spots are available and requesting fees. Please note:

  • Comments offering vendor spots are not legitimate.
  • Expo Idaho does not handle vendors for events hosted at our venue.
  • Vendors are contacted only by the event organizers, not through comments or random messages.
  • Applications and fees are handled directly through the event organizers’ official channels.

 
If you receive a suspicious message, do not engage or send payment. Contact the event organizer directly using their official website. Please ignore and report these comments or messages. Stay safe.
